Nikhil Dwivedi will apparently play the dreaded gangster Abu Salem in his forthcoming film

Bollywood recently has seen an upswing in the number of gangster films being churned out. Now we hear that actor Nikhil Dwivedi is gearing up to play dreaded gangster Abu Salem in his next. His character will be called Captain, an alias for Salem in the underworld.

A reliable source associated with the project, to be produced by Suryaveer Singh, and scheduled to start later this year, says, "Currently, Surya and Nikhil are tied up with their upcoming film, a hard-hitting love story. After its release in about three months they will start the preparations for the film on Salem," we are told.

Earlier, it was speculated that the producer's current film helmed Navneet Bahl-Bharat Arora, was actually based on the Abu Salem-Monica Bedi love story with Richa Chadda playing the gangster's sweetheart.

However, our source maintains that the film has nothing to do with the gangster. The new project, tentatively titled Captain, is scheduled to start later this year.

The film will be shot in Mumbai, Dubai, South Africa and United States. Asked about skipping Portugal, where the don was nabbed with his girlfriend, our source replies, "Some parts of South Africa will be used for the scenes set in Portugal."
